Average Teacher Salary in Twiggs County School District
The average teacher salary in Twiggs County School District is $42,860.
| Grade Level | Average | 10th percentile | 25th percentile | Median | 75th percentile | 90th percentile |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Pre-school | $23,450 | $14,670 | $16,060 | $21,230 | $25,310 | $42,210 |
| Kindergarten | $45,010 | $33,600 | $37,630 | $44,270 | $51,600 | $61,570 |
| Elementary | $47,780 | $33,370 | $38,930 | $47,550 | $57,580 | $64,650 |
| Middle school | $48,950 | $33,400 | $38,290 | $49,230 | $59,200 | $65,980 |
| High school | $49,110 | $32,550 | $38,850 | $47,740 | $59,920 | $68,760 |

General Facts
- Staff: 190
- Full time teachers: 74
- Pupil to teacher ratio: 11 to 1
- Teacher assistants (instructional aides): 25
- Instructional Coordinators: 2
- Elementary Teachers: 32
- Kindergarten Teachers: 5
- Pre-K Teachers: 4
- High School Teachers: 33
- Pre-K to 12 Students: 1,038
Financial Statistics for Twiggs County School District
Revenue
- Revenue from local sources: $4,781,000
- Revenue from state sources: $6,469,000
- Revenue from federal sources: $3,105,000
- Total revenue: $14,355,000
Expenses
- Expenditures on instruction: $6,441,000
- Expenditures on teacher salary: $6,912,000
- Expenditures on teacher benefits: $2,222,000
- Expenditures per student: $45,000
- Total expenditures: $11,787,000
Breakdown of Teacher Salary Expenses
- Teacher salary expenses on regular education: $2,905,000
- Teacher salary expenses on special education: $583,000
- Teacher salary expenses on vocational education: $212,000
